How games helped rejuvenate LEGO

Toy manufacturer LEGO says that video games have helped the firm beat the economic downturn.

Traveller’s Tales’ games – which have included LEGO Star Wars, LEGO Indiana Jones, LEGO Harry Potter, LEGO Batman and LEGO Pirates of the Caribbean – have been regular best sellers since 2005.

LEGO’s VP and general manager for UK and Ireland Drew Brazer said: If I go back to 2008 and 2009, that’s when our business really started to take off. And we weren’t exactly sure why, so we did some consumer research to understand this. What’s really explaining this meteoric rise in sales?

One of the key factors was the synergy between the LEGO video games and the products. Boys were playing these games, engaged in LEGO, seeing LEGO products come to life in the video game, and it created tremendous interest for them to go out and buy the physical product. So it’s been great.”

LEGO Lord of the Rings is due on November 23rd. LEGO City Undercover is set for release exclusively on Wii U and 3DS.
